Frequently Asked Questions about Grand Rapids

How much are Studio apartments in Grand Rapids?

There are currently 198 Studio Apartments in Grand Rapids with rent ranges from $440 to $2,500 with an average price of $1,923.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Grand Rapids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Grand Rapids ranges from $440 to $4,492 with an average monthly rent of $1,517.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Grand Rapids c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Grand Rapids range from $500 to $4,102.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,794.

How expensive are Grand Rapids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 156 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Grand Rapids on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$555 to $4,369 - averaging $2,281 for the location.
